No, but obviously this is a much-loved game

My emulator is a fairly recent implementation: https://github.com/nullobject/rygar-emu

I wrote it mostly to learn how the Rygar arcade hardware works. Everything I learned when writing the emulator helped me to write a FPGA core for the MiSTer platform, which re-creates the original arcade hardware at a chip-level.

I'm just putting the finishing touches on the FPGA core now.
